(7)IDEA 14.1 安装MyBatis插件

    xiaoxiao2021-03-25  99

    引言安装MyBatis插件使用MyBatis插件生成代码

    1.引言

          在本篇博客中主要介绍一下,在IDEA14.1 版本中安装MyBatis插件,通过插件生成我们的持久化类和映射文件来简化我们的开发。

          在这里我提供MyBatis插件的下载地址为:MyBatis_plus,这个插件只能保证使用在IDEA14.1的版本中,其他版本的IDEA可能无法使用。

    2.安装MyBatis插件

    首先下载MyBatis插件

    打开IDEA软件,安装我们的插件

    找到我们硬盘上的插件,点击确定

    插件安装成功,点击应用

    重启IDEA软件,成功

    3.使用MyBatis插件生成代码

    首先新建一个maven工程(可以是普通工程)

    创建一个generatorConfig.xml配置文件

    配置文件中写入相关信息 <?xml version="1.0" encoding="UTF-8"?> <!DOCTYPE generatorConfiguration PUBLIC "-//mybatis.org//DTD MyBatis Generator Configuration 1.0//EN" "http://mybatis.org/dtd/mybatis-generator-config_1_0.dtd"> <generatorConfiguration> <!-- 硬盘上驱动包的路径,必须是绝对路径 --> <classPathEntry location="D:\mavenhome\mysql\mysql-connector-java\5.1.30\mysql-connector-java-5.1.30.jar"/> <!-- 指定运行环境是mybatis3的版本 --> <context id="testTables" targetRuntime="MyBatis3"> <commentGenerator> <!-- 是否取消注释 --> <property name="suppressAllComments" value="true" /> <!-- 是否生成注释代时间戳 --> <property name="suppressDate" value="true" /> </commentGenerator> <!-- jdbc 连接信息 --> <jdbcConnection driverClass="com.mysql.jdbc.Driver" connectionURL="jdbc:mysql://localhost:3306/school?useUnicode=true&characterEncoding=UTF-8" userId="root" password="root"> </jdbcConnection> <!-- targetPackage指定模型在生成在哪个包 ,targetProject指定项目的src,--> <javaModelGenerator targetPackage="com.skd.domain" targetProject="test/src/main/java"> <!-- 去除字段前后空格 --> <property name="trimStrings" value="true" /> </javaModelGenerator> <!-- 指定映射文件的位置 --> <sqlMapGenerator targetPackage="com.skd.domain" targetProject="test/src/main/java" /> <!-- Mapper(Dao)类生成的位置 --> <javaClientGenerator type="XMLMAPPER" targetPackage="com.skd.dao" targetProject="test/src/main/java" /> <!-- tableName:数据库表的名字, domainObjectName:生成持久化类的名称--> <table tableName="student" domainObjectName="Student" /> </context> </generatorConfiguration> 记得创建相应的包

    右键生成

    转载请注明原文地址: https://ju.6miu.com/read-13656.html

    最新回复(0)